National League 2N

Craven swoops at death in thriller

By DESMOND HICKIE

Chester..................... 17
Wharfedale............ 16
THIS match was tight. Wharfedale regained the lead after 71 minutes, only for Chester to grab it back in injury time. The visitors largely dominated possession and territory, but could not make it count.
Wharfedale were consistently able to find space down the Chester right early on. However, their first try came after a chapter of errors. Two poor passes, a hack on and a bounce off a post, interspersed with a fine Ryan Carlson break, allowed Jack Blakeney-Edwards to score.
